Electrons in Metals.

Abstract

The International Conference on Electron Lifetimes in Metals was held at the University of Oregon from July 7-12, 1974. The 48 papers presented at the conference were divided into 17 invited papers and 31 contributed papers. Individual conference sessions were held on each of the following topics: Phonons, Lattice defects, Impurities, Magnetic impurities, Bulk measurements, Mean free paths: Various Techniques, and Alloys. This report contains the program and abstracts of the meeting.
